Transaction 8994ee6b2656c55c9fc10a664eae8cbacf8b78ab93b7f82f34cb77eb07aa1ebe
1 Input
1 Output
-
8994ee6b2656c55c9fc10a664eae8cbacf8b78ab93b7f82f34cb77eb07aa1ebe:0
- value
- 11959094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26db11fff605bc77d8f002bceb48867a7f88ec0d OP_EQUAL
- address
- 35EU374usvU2Cknwrxzk86ULvgVUraNkT2